NHTSA Proposes National AV Framework with Preemptive Authority and Emergency Protocols
Federal regulators are moving to replace state-by-state autonomous vehicle rules with a single national standard, mandating strict new emergency coordination protocols for robotaxis.

The competing cases
Federal Preemption
A single, nationwide set of performance and safety standards that overrides local municipal control.
For: Unlocks economies of scale by allowing developers to build one system for the entire country, drastically reducing compliance overhead. Against: Strips local municipalities of the ability to regulate or ban fleets that disrupt their specific infrastructure. Evidence: The $5 million ASCEND consortium aims to finalize these standards, while the new 2,500-vehicle exemption proves federal regulators want to accelerate deployment. Fits well when: The core technology is mature enough that edge cases are rare and standardized emergency protocols (like the 30-second hotline response) are universally respected. Does not fit when: Local infrastructure varies wildly, requiring bespoke operational rules that a blanket federal standard cannot accommodate.
Localized Patchwork
The current system where states and cities set their own testing, deployment, and operational rules.
For: Allows cities to act as regulatory sandboxes, tightly controlling deployments and instantly revoking permits if safety is compromised. Against: Creates a fragmented market where an AV legal in Arizona might be banned in New York, destroying the economics of scale. Evidence: State lawmakers and unions have actively opposed and blocked driverless expansions when local safety concerns are not met. Fits well when: The technology is still experimental and prone to localized failures, such as fleet bricking during major public events that block first responders. Does not fit when: The industry needs to transition from pilot programs to profitable, nationwide commercial networks.
On July 4, 2026, a fleet of robotaxis abruptly ceased functioning in the middle of San Francisco, creating a predictable but chaotic blockade that obstructed emergency responders. This was not a hypothetical edge case; it was a systemic failure during a major, heavily forecasted public event. The resulting gridlock forced city officials and first responders to navigate around multi-ton autonomous vehicles that refused to move, highlighting a glaring gap in how driverless systems interact with real-world emergencies.[1][4]
The regulatory hammer dropped weeks later. The National Highway Traffic Safety Administration (NHTSA), the federal agency tasked with writing and enforcing Federal Motor Vehicle Safety Standards, announced a sweeping package of policy moves designed to establish a national autonomous vehicle framework. The explicit goal is to replace the chaotic, state-by-state regulatory patchwork with a single preemptive standard that governs how autonomous vehicles operate nationwide.[2][3][4]
The core of this technical push is the newly announced ASCEND consortium, backed by a three-year, $5 million partnership with SAE Industry Technologies Consortia. Rather than relying on the current system where manufacturers self-certify their vehicles, ASCEND aims to write the first-ever national AV performance standards. This represents a fundamental shift from reactive oversight to proactive, hard-coded federal rules.[2][4]
However, the most immediate and aggressive bite comes from the emergency coordination mandates. Driven by the AV Emergency Response Coordination Act introduced in Congress, the framework targets the exact failure mode witnessed in San Francisco. The legislation strips away the ambiguity of how an autonomous vehicle should behave when flashing lights approach.[1][4]

The proposed rules mandate that AV operators maintain a 24/7 emergency hotline with a strict 30-second response standard. Furthermore, it establishes a federal process for "geofence notices." This mechanism allows local authorities to compel autonomous fleets to avoid an active emergency area for up to 72 hours, demanding compliance within a tight two-minute window.[4]
The skeptical view, however, notes the vast difference between a proposed framework and a shipped reality. While NHTSA is actively granting commercial exemptions—such as allowing developers to deploy up to 2,500 non-compliant robotaxis annually—the actual preemptive federal standards are still years away from final rulemaking. The industry is currently operating on promises and interim rules.[2][3]
Until the ASCEND consortium delivers its final standards, the autonomous vehicle sector remains in a transitional gray zone. Companies are aggressively scaling their deployments in friendly jurisdictions, while facing severe backlash and potential camera-only bans in states demanding stricter oversight. The tension between rapid deployment and public safety has never been higher.[1][3]
The ultimate trade-off pits rapid, localized innovation against standardized, national safety. A preemptive federal framework promises to unlock nationwide scaling for AV developers, but it fundamentally strips cities of the power to eject fleets that repeatedly block their fire trucks. As the rules are written over the next three years, the balance of power will permanently shift from local municipalities to federal regulators.[1][4]
